Papers of Roderick Redman
| Title |
Correspondence with D.E. Blackwell |
| Reference |
RGO 37/175 |
| Covering Dates |
28 Nov. 1972–30 Nov. 1972 |
| Extent and Medium |
2 pages |
|
| Content and context |
A copy of a letter from Redman to D.E. Blackwell, 26 November 1972, and Blackwell's reply of 30 November, regarding opinion at Oxford moving towards favouring a Cassegrain spectrograph. |
